Everllence completes first factory test of 18V51/60 engine running on B100 biofuel


French facility tests 18,900 kW engine converted to run entirely on biofuel in Corsica.

Everllence has completed factory testing of its 18V51/60 engine converted to run on B100 biofuel, marking the first time the diesel engine has operated entirely on the renewable fuel. Everllence has completed the first factory acceptance test of its 18V51/60 engine running entirely on B100 biofuel at its Saint-Nazaire facility in France.

Although the B100 test focuses on a stationary, grid‑connected unit, the successful demonstration of the 18V51/60 running fully on B100 biofuel underlines that the same engine platform could be adapted for biofuel‑enabled marine or floating‑power duties, provided fuel‑supply, safety, and regulatory requirements are met.

The 18-cylinder, four-stroke engine has an output of 18,900 kilowatts and was fully converted to run on B100 instead of diesel. Everllence said the 15-minute trial marked a historic milestone for the engine platform.

Romain Hérault, test engineer at Everllence’s Saint-Nazaire factory, remarked: “We started with a blank page and reconfigured the engine from scratch. The test demonstrated it’s able to reach full potential running on biofuel.”

The engine is one of eight units destined for a new 130-megawatt power plant in Corsica being developed by EDF PEI. Everllence noted that the facility is expected to generate electricity for about one-third of the island, or 110,000 households.

Ahead of the trial, Hérault and his team first ran the engine on fossil fuel to establish baseline performance data, before flushing and cleaning the unit to remove residue. The 18V51/60 tested at Saint-Nazaire is about 13 metres long, almost five metres wide and weighs around 325 metric tonnes.

Everllence stated that B100 biofuel, derived from natural oils such as rapeseed, can cut CO₂ emissions by roughly 60% compared with fossil fuels. The biofuel used at the Saint-Nazaire site was sourced from farmers within a 200-kilometre radius of the factory.

Céline Ernoult, project manager at Everllence, commented: “We’re dealing with big engines, but we also want to move in a greener direction. The idea is to keep the engines, but lower their environmental impact with biofuel.”

Cédric Dupuis, EDF PEI project director for the new Corsica power plant, highlighted that the state-owned company already operates 43 Everllence engines on France’s islands and that the new Corsica plant will raise that total to 51. He also said EDF PEI aims for all its sites to be running on biofuel by 2030.

The engines are scheduled to be shipped to Corsica in early 2026, with the new plant expected to begin operations progressively from mid-2027, replacing the old Le Vazzio fossil fuel facility on the island.

The 18V51/60 engine family is not limited to land‑based power plants; it is also used in marine and floating‑power applications, including on Karpowership’s 'Powerships', where the 18V51/60DF dual‑fuel variant operates on natural gas and can burn liquid biofuels and other liquid fuels.
